Understanding the YSL Foundation Landscape: BD55's Place in the Lineup
Before focusing solely on BD55, it's crucial to understand the different YSL foundations that offer this coveted shade. The most common iterations featuring BD55 are:
* YSL All Hours Foundation Full Coverage BD55 Warm Toffee: This is arguably the most popular formulation associated with BD55. Known for its long-lasting, full-coverage finish, this foundation is a staple for those seeking flawless, all-day wear. Its matte finish controls shine, making it ideal for oily or combination skin types. The "All Hours" moniker accurately reflects its staying power, resisting smudging and fading throughout the day. This is a key contender when considering a low-buy or no-buy strategy, as its longevity reduces the need for frequent repurchases. Availability can be found on the Saint Laurent Official Online Store and various authorized retailers.
* Yves Saint Laurent Touche Éclat Le Teint Foundation in BD55: This foundation offers a more luminous and buildable coverage compared to the All Hours formula. It provides a natural, radiant finish, making it suitable for those who prefer a less heavy-handed approach to makeup. While still offering good staying power, it’s less matte than the All Hours, making it a better option for those with drier skin. Again, the shade BD55 translates beautifully in this formula, offering a similar warm toffee tone.

* YSL BD55 Warm Praline Fusion Ink Foundation SPF 18: This foundation represents a slightly different texture and finish. The "Fusion Ink" formula suggests a more fluid and lightweight application, possibly with a more natural, skin-like finish. The inclusion of SPF 18 is a bonus for those seeking sun protection in their foundation. However, the "Warm Praline" descriptor might subtly differ in undertone compared to the "Warm Toffee" in other lines. Careful comparison of shade descriptions is essential before purchasing.
